The BAHAMAS project aims to develop a biological treatment for conserving metal artefacts by transforming existing corrosion products into more stable metal oxalates. This innovative approach seeks to enhance the protection of cultural heritage objects while preserving their physical appearance.
The nature of the corrosion products present on the surface of artistic and archaeological metal artefacts is intrinsically related to the environmental context (atmospheric or burial).
In order to effectively protect and inhibit the corrosion of such metal objects, the practices adopted should take into account the nature of the patina and its corrosion behaviour.
